May 28, 1689
A CONTINUATION OF THE PROCEEDINGS OF THE CONVENTION OF THE ESTATES IN SCOTLAND, London, England, May 28, 1689  The year of this issue is printed in the dateline of the lead article on the front page, as the dateline contains only the month and day (see). This is issue #24 of a short-lived title which existed to report on the ongoing disputes between the Scots and English. The entire front page is taken up with various reports from Edinburgh, which carries over to take most of the back page as well. There is one advertisement near the bottom of the bkpg.
Complete as a single sheet newspaper with wide, untrimmed margins, measures 7 1/2 by 12 1/4 inches, great condition.
